+   enum isl_format format = isl_format_for_pipe_format(pformat);
+   struct isl_swizzle swizzle = ISL_SWIZZLE_IDENTITY;
+
+   if (format == ISL_FORMAT_UNSUPPORTED)
+      return (struct iris_format_info) { .fmt = format, .swizzle = swizzle };
+
+   const struct isl_format_layout *fmtl = isl_format_get_layout(format);
+
+   if (!util_format_is_srgb(pformat)) {
+      if (util_format_is_intensity(pformat)) {
+         swizzle = ISL_SWIZZLE(RED, RED, RED, RED);
+      } else if (util_format_is_luminance(pformat)) {
+         swizzle = ISL_SWIZZLE(RED, RED, RED, ONE);
+      } else if (util_format_is_luminance_alpha(pformat)) {
+         swizzle = ISL_SWIZZLE(RED, RED, RED, GREEN);
+      } else if (util_format_is_alpha(pformat)) {
+         swizzle = ISL_SWIZZLE(ZERO, ZERO, ZERO, RED);
+      }
+   }
+
+   /* When faking RGBX pipe formats with RGBA ISL formats, override alpha. */
+   if (!util_format_has_alpha(pformat) && fmtl->channels.a.type != ISL_VOID) {
+      swizzle = ISL_SWIZZLE(RED, GREEN, BLUE, ONE);
+   }
+
+   if ((usage & ISL_SURF_USAGE_RENDER_TARGET_BIT) &&
+       pformat == PIPE_FORMAT_A8_UNORM) {
+      /* Most of the hardware A/LA formats are not renderable, except
+       * for A8_UNORM.  SURFACE_STATE's shader channel select fields
+       * cannot be used to swap RGB and A channels when rendering (as
+       * it could impact alpha blending), so we have to use the actual
+       * A8_UNORM format when rendering.
+       */
+      format = ISL_FORMAT_A8_UNORM;
+      swizzle = ISL_SWIZZLE_IDENTITY;
+   }
+
+   /* We choose RGBA over RGBX for rendering the hardware doesn't support
+    * rendering to RGBX. However, when this internal override is used on Gen9+,
+    * fast clears don't work correctly.
+    *
+    * i965 fixes this by pretending to not support RGBX formats, and the higher
+    * layers of Mesa pick the RGBA format instead. Gallium doesn't work that
+    * way, and might choose a different format, like BGRX instead of RGBX,
+    * which will also cause problems when sampling from a surface fast cleared
+    * as RGBX. So we always choose RGBA instead of RGBX explicitly
+    * here.
+    */
+   if (isl_format_is_rgbx(format) &&
+       !isl_format_supports_rendering(devinfo, format)) {
+      format = isl_format_rgbx_to_rgba(format);
+      swizzle = ISL_SWIZZLE(RED, GREEN, BLUE, ONE);
+   }
+
+   return (struct iris_format_info) { .fmt = format, .swizzle = swizzle };
 }

+   if (usage & PIPE_BIND_RENDER_TARGET) {
+      /* Alpha and luminance-alpha formats other than A8_UNORM are not
+       * renderable.  For texturing, we can use R or RG formats with
+       * shader channel selects (SCS) to swizzle the data into the correct
+       * channels.  But for render targets, the hardware prohibits using
+       * SCS to move shader outputs between the RGB and A channels, as it
+       * would alter what data is used for alpha blending.
+       *
+       * For BLORP, we can apply the swizzle in the shader.  But for
+       * general rendering, this would mean recompiling the shader, which
+       * we'd like to avoid doing.  So we mark these formats non-renderable.
+       *
+       * We do support A8_UNORM as it's required and is renderable.
+       */
+      if (pformat != PIPE_FORMAT_A8_UNORM &&
+          (util_format_is_alpha(pformat) ||
+           util_format_is_luminance_alpha(pformat)))
+         supported = false;
+
+      enum isl_format rt_format = format;
+
+      if (isl_format_is_rgbx(format) &&
+          !isl_format_supports_rendering(devinfo, format))
+         rt_format = isl_format_rgbx_to_rgba(format);
+
+      supported &= isl_format_supports_rendering(devinfo, rt_format);
+
+      if (!is_integer)
+         supported &= isl_format_supports_alpha_blending(devinfo, rt_format);
+   }
 
    if (usage & PIPE_BIND_SHADER_IMAGE) {
-      // XXX: allow untyped reads
-      supported &= isl_format_supports_typed_reads(devinfo, format) &&
-                   isl_format_supports_typed_writes(devinfo, format);
+      /* Dataport doesn't support compression, and we can't resolve an MCS
+       * compressed surface.  (Buffer images may have sample count of 0.)
+       */
+      supported &= sample_count == 0;
+
+      supported &= isl_format_supports_typed_writes(devinfo, format);
+      supported &= isl_has_matching_typed_storage_image_format(devinfo, format);
    }
 
-   if (usage & PIPE_BIND_SAMPLER_VIEW)
+   if (usage & PIPE_BIND_SAMPLER_VIEW) {
       supported &= isl_format_supports_sampling(devinfo, format);
+      if (!is_integer)
+         supported &= isl_format_supports_filtering(devinfo, format);
+
+      /* Don't advertise 3-component RGB formats for non-buffer textures.
+       * This ensures that they are renderable from an API perspective since
+       * gallium frontends will fall back to RGBA or RGBX, which are
+       * renderable.  We want to render internally for copies and blits,
+       * even if the application doesn't.
+       *
+       * Buffer textures don't need to be renderable, so we support real RGB.
+       * This is useful for PBO upload, and 32-bit RGB support is mandatory.
+       */
+      if (target != PIPE_BUFFER)
+         supported &= fmtl->bpb != 24 && fmtl->bpb != 48 && fmtl->bpb != 96;
+   }
